Disneyland-- and only because it has been maintained better.

In 1996 they added the "Here Comes The Bride" organist to the attic.

As part of the "Haunted Mansion Holiday" construction, the attraction was repaired from top to bottom (new scrims were added, new speakers were installed, light fixtures were replaced, animatronics were improved, etc.)

I certainly like WDW's three additional rooms (hallway of portraits, library, and organist)... but the portraits in the queue are better appreciated there, DL's organist is much more sophisticated, and the busts that "stare at you" are much more convincing when you can walk around them and jump up and down and the eyes still follow you.

The Phantom Manor at Disneyland Paris wins!! Don't get me wrong - I love them all but there just seems to be something different about the on eon Paris. The seance part is done much better then in WDW and the end scene going through a Wild West Ghost Town is excellent.

I've only really been on the ones from Disney World and Disney Land Paris, but i think their both amazing! They share the same concept and almost the same storyline but DLP's version seems to be more intricate than the WDW's version that one seems more fun and Phantom Manor is a lot more melancholic which i love so much...

the architecture on each house is amazing too! While Disney Worlds is a lot more larger and grander etc, Phantom Manor actually feels like a macabre broken down home shrouded in secrecy...

I also like the romance that is involved in PM's storyline so either way i think that for me PM wins... but the HM at Disney World will follow close behind.
